????(−2, 10) is the midpoint of . If ???????? has coordinates (4, −5), what are the coordinates of ?????
Sonbull [250]

Answer:

The coordinates of B are (-8,25).

Step-by-step explanation:

Consider the completer question is " M(−2, 10) is the midpoint of AB. If A has coordinates (4, −5), what are the coordinates of B".

Let coordinates of B are (a,b).

Formula for midpoint:

Midpoint=(\dfrac{x_1+x_2}{2},\dfrac{y_1+y_2}{2})

Midpoint of A and B is

Midpoint=(\dfrac{4+a}{2},\dfrac{-5+b}{2})

It is given that M(−2, 10) is the midpoint of AB.

(-2,10)=(\dfrac{4+a}{2},\dfrac{-5+b}{2})

On comparing both sides we get

-2=\dfrac{4+a}{2}

Multiply both sides by 2.

-4=4+a

Subtract 4 from both sides.

-8=a

The value of a is 8.

Similarly,

10=\dfrac{-5+b}{2}

Multiply both sides by 2.

20=-5+b

Add 5 on both sides.

25=b

Therefore, the coordinates of B are (-8,25).
